摘要
根据宁夏某氧化铜矿物性质,提出了稀硫酸柱浸—置换生产海绵铜工艺流程。试验得出的最佳条件为:碎矿粒度-20mm,硫酸溶液浓度2%,喷淋强度10L/m2·h,浸出35d,铜浸出率达89.47%,置换率96.70%~99.27%,海绵含铜77.44%~72.66%。
The Process of 'column leaching by diluted sulphuric acid-replacement' was put forward according to the ores' properties. The tests showed that the optimum ore size is -20mm, the concentration of sulphuric acid 2%, spray speed 10L/m 2·h and leaching time 35d. Under the optimum technological conditions, the leaching rate was 89.47%, replacement rate 96.70-99.27%, and the Cu content of sponge copper 77.44-72.66%.
